Fresh Green Bean Casserole
Updated family classic with fresh vegetables and creamy cheeses. *If you want a sweeter taste use more cream cheese to goat cheese. If you would like it tangier use more goat cheese than cream cheese. Ingredients
- 2lbs green beans
- 1 large onion
- 1 small pepper
- 6oz fresh button mushrooms sliced
- 3oz cream cheese
- 3oz goat cheese
- olive oil
- soy sauce OR balsamic vinegar
- brown sugar
- bread crumbs
- flat leaf parsley (optional)
Directions
- Start with fresh whole beans, trimmed or frozen green beans. Cook in a small amount of boiling water - just enough to cover - for about 3 minutes
- In a casserole combine green beans with fresh button mushrooms and sliced red sweet peppers. Toss with olive oil and soy sauce or balsamic vinegar to coat. Roast at 375 F for 15 minutes.
- Sweeten onion wedges by sauteeing in olive oil and brow sugar until tender. Toss with dry bread crumbsto coat for classic onion ring crispiness.
- For a note of tanginess, blend softened cream cheese with goat cheese.
- Toss with warm vegetables and place in baking dish. Top with onions.
- Bake in 400F oven 5-8 minutes just until heated through and onion rings are crispy.
- Garnish with snipped fresh parsley
